Procurement, a critical function in business operations, traditionally faces inefficiencies, potential disputes, and high costs due to reliance on manual processes and intermediaries. Blockchain technology and smart contracts are poised to transform procurement by introducing automation, transparency, and enhanced security. This article delves into the practical applications, benefits, and challenges of integrating these technologies into procurement systems.

Understanding Blockchain and Smart Contracts

Blockchain is a decentralized digital ledger that records transactions across multiple computers in a way that ensures security and transparency. Each transaction, or “block,” is linked to the previous one, forming a “chain” that is immutable and accessible to all participants in the network. This decentralized nature eliminates the need for intermediaries and reduces the risk of fraud.

Smart contracts are self-executing contracts where the terms are directly written into code. These contracts automatically enforce and execute the terms when predefined conditions are met, significantly reducing the need for manual intervention and third-party verification.

Key Benefits of Blockchain and Smart Contracts in Procurement

  1. Enhanced Transparency and Traceability: Blockchain’s immutable ledger ensures that all transactions are recorded and visible to authorized stakeholders, providing a clear audit trail from the initial order to the final delivery. This transparency helps in quickly identifying and resolving bottlenecks and inefficiencies in the supply chain (Core Devs Ltd, TokenMinds).
  2. Fraud Prevention and Security: The decentralized and tamper-proof nature of blockchain technology makes it highly resistant to fraud. Smart contracts further enhance security by ensuring that contract terms are automatically enforced without the possibility of manipulation (Procurement Tactics, Core Devs Ltd).
  3. Improved Efficiency: By automating routine procurement tasks such as purchase orders, invoicing, and payments, smart contracts streamline operations, reduce paperwork, and minimize human errors. This leads to faster processing times and significant cost savings (Procurement Tactics, Oboloo).
  4. Better Supplier Management: Blockchain can store verified records of suppliers’ credentials, performance history, and compliance, making it easier for organizations to select and manage suppliers. This fosters trust and accountability in supplier relationships (TokenMinds, Core Devs Ltd).
  5. Real-Time Inventory Tracking: Integrating blockchain with IoT sensors enables real-time tracking of inventory levels and movements, helping organizations optimize stock levels and reduce the risks of overstocking or understocking (TokenMinds, Procurement Tactics).

Practical Applications in Procurement

  1. Automated Purchase Orders and Payments: Smart contracts can automate the entire procurement cycle by triggering payments once goods are delivered and conditions are met, eliminating delays and reducing the need for manual verification.
  2. Compliance and Audit: Blockchain’s transparent and immutable records simplify compliance with regulatory requirements and make auditing processes more straightforward.
  3. Multi-Party Collaboration: Large-scale projects involving multiple stakeholders can benefit from the coordination provided by blockchain, reducing delays and miscommunications (TokenMinds, Core Devs Ltd).

Challenges and Considerations

Despite its advantages, the adoption of blockchain in procurement faces several challenges:

  1. Legal and Regulatory Issues: The legal status of smart contracts and blockchain transactions is still evolving, with different jurisdictions having varying levels of acceptance and enforceability.
  2. Technical Expertise: Implementing blockchain solutions requires specialized knowledge and skills, which may not be readily available within all organizations.
  3. Integration with Existing Systems: Many current procurement systems may need significant modifications to integrate seamlessly with blockchain technology.
  4. Scalability and Cost: Blockchain networks can be slower and more expensive than traditional databases, particularly for large-scale operations with high transaction volumes (Procurement Tactics, Core Devs Ltd).
